SPORTS AND PASTIMES.

BOWLING TIT BITS.

[By "Jack."]

Since my lufei "Tifc Bits," the local green has been well imtronizod, and a large number of matches played. The competitions are being filtered into with great interest, and members seem disposed to get their matches off to time. TJamb (S) 13. ****** The Masterton' contingent of four rinks did very well in the "Centre" match between Wellington and Wairarapa, winning three of its four matches. The only other win was scored by one of the three Carterton rinks. The representative rinks from Greytown ,(2) and Featherston (1), ■all suffered '(.defeat; The,,.'.aggregate scores were:' Wellington 222, Wairarapa 168. ****** Half the >. Masterton,.,;, contingent above mentioned played r a friendly match with the Newtown club's representatives, . and 'spent a most enjoyable time. The Newtownites, however, won both matches by an aggregate majority of 10 points. •..•***** In the Dixon Cup match, to be played at Pahiatua on Saturday next, Masterton will be represented.by W. Pragnell, E. J. Rose, W. Reed' and 0. Pragnell (skip). The task ahead of these bowlers is a formidable one, but it is anticipated" that the game will be strenuously contested.
